Core Insights - The 2024 Guangzhou International Auto Show highlights significant trends in the automotive industry, showcasing 29 standout new models from over 100 launches, indicating a shift towards integrating vehicles into daily life rather than merely serving as transportation tools [1][2]. Group 1: Key Trends in the Automotive Industry - The trend of increasing penetration of new energy vehicles (NEVs) continues, with a clear commitment to advancing NEV development in China [2]. - Traditional foreign automakers are intensifying their investments in the Chinese market despite facing challenges, with brands like Mercedes-Benz and Audi developing models specifically for this market [2]. - The concept of "car + life" has transitioned from theory to practice, with vehicles increasingly becoming integrated into consumers' lifestyles through advancements in technology [2]. Group 2: International Perspectives on Chinese Automotive Brands - There is a notable increase in acceptance of Chinese electric vehicles (EVs) in overseas markets, particularly in emerging markets like Brazil, where local brands have established a presence [3]. - Competition in different markets varies, with Brazil still focused on traditional vehicles due to inadequate infrastructure for EVs, highlighting a need for performance and range as key competitive factors [3][4]. Group 3: Technological Advancements and Ecosystem Development - The importance of ecological and open-source standardization is emphasized, with a focus on creating a collaborative environment among automakers to enhance innovation [5]. - The potential for integrating various applications into vehicles is significant, as cars evolve into living spaces that can accommodate diverse functionalities [5]. - The rollout of Level 3 autonomous driving technology is progressing, with a focus on how it will transform user experiences and the implications for safety and insurance [6]. Group 4: Future Outlook for the Automotive Industry - The future of the automotive industry is expected to center around smart technology as a core competitive element, with a strong emphasis on self-sufficiency in the supply chain, particularly regarding chips and operating systems [7]. - There is an anticipation for joint ventures and partnerships to continue strengthening the Chinese market, with hopes for a diverse and competitive landscape among brands [7].
